CMC is a term used to communicate between two or more people who can interact with each other through different computer. However, computer is not used as much and often now. Around 90's, computers began to spread in community and came the term Computer Mediated Communication because people started to use websites, emails, and the internet at the time. Computer Mediated Communication (CMC) is any form of human communication gained or aided by computer technology. In addition, communication with computer media (CMC) can also be defined as communication transactions that occur through two or more related computers. Examples such as chat, instant messaging, SMS (Short Message Service), and email. In addition, this programme is created for long distance learning and teaching.
There are five types of CMC. They are:
a) Asynchronous CMC
- Communication is not synchronised
- messages are not exchanged or replied to immediately
- eg: emails, internet forums, most social media used this
b) Synchronous CMC
- Communication is rather synchronised
- messages are faster can be exchanged and replied to
- eg: internet chatrooms, video/audio conferencing
c) CMC and Long-distance learning
- allows teacher and learner to interact without being in the same location
- eg: Skype
d) Collaborative learning
- Computer-Supported Collaborative Learning
- can help enhance peer interactions and group works
- eg: Google Docs, Google Drive
e) Authentic Communication
- CMC offers learners easy access and opportunity to communicate with other learners
